Target Store in West Ellicott Resolves Property Tax Dispute
Target Corporation has officially ended its legal battle regarding the property tax assessment for its store located at 975 Fairmount Avenue in West Ellicott. The company previously sought intervention from state Supreme Court Justice Grace Hanlon to reduce the assessed value from $3.4 million to $1.7 million for the tax years spanning 2023-2026.
Details of the Tax Assessment Challenge
This recent challenge marked the second occasion in a few years where Target petitioned for a decrease in its tax assessment. In the earlier 2022 assessment, the former K-Mart property was similarly valued at $3.4 million. Following negotiations between legal representatives, a court settlement resulted in maintaining the original tax assessment.
Court Settlement and Future Assessments
The decision, finalized in late August 2023, confirmed that the $3.4 million assessment would remain in effect for the 2023-24 and 2024-25 tax years. Additionally, as part of this settlement, the town of Ellicott has agreed to approve a 485-B tax exemption starting from the 2025 assessment on the property.
Understanding the 485-B Tax Exemption
The 485-B tax exemption offers significant financial relief to property owners by providing a 50% reduction on the increased assessed value resulting from improvements made to the property. This law covers various types of commercial, business, or industrial activities.
- Target’s initial purchase price for the building was $3.15 million.
- The company plans to invest approximately $4.5 million in improvements.
- The exemption will phase in 50% of any tax assessment increase due to these enhancements.
